What are F-centers in an ionic crystal ?

In an ionic crystal, F-centers, also known as color centers, are defects that arise when an anion vacancy is created due to the loss of an anion (negatively charged ion) from its lattice site. This creates a localized region of positive charge within the crystal lattice.

The term "F-center" comes from the German word "farbe," meaning color. These defects are often responsible for the coloration of certain crystals. For example, in sodium chloride (NaCl), common table salt, F-centers are responsible for the yellow coloration observed in irradiated or thermally treated crystals.

The color arises because the F-center can absorb photons of specific wavelengths corresponding to the energy difference between electronic states within the crystal lattice. The absorbed energy promotes electrons from the valence band to higher energy levels within the defect, creating a characteristic color in the visible spectrum.

F-centers can significantly influence the optical and electronic properties of ionic crystals, making them important in various applications, including materials science, optoelectronics, and solid-state physics.
